Empathy
The capacity to understand or feel what another being is experiencing from within their frame of reference, essentially placing oneself in another's position.
Three-mountain Task
A cognitive development assessment where children are asked to choose pictures that represent different perspectives of a model mountain range, testing their ability to understand and differentiate viewpoints.
Egocentrism
The cognitive inability to understand or assume any perspective other than one's own, commonly seen in early childhood development.
Piaget
Swiss psychologist known for his pioneering work in child development and his theory of cognitive development explaining how children acquire knowledge.
